Drawing from his role leading the Science Division at the Hubble Space Telescope Institute, Mario Livio explores the enigmatic number phi, or the Golden Ratio, tracing its appearances from ancient geometry to modern science and art. You gain insights into how this ratio links natural forms like shells and flowers with architectural marvels and even financial markets, backed by stories of historical figures including Fibonacci and Kepler. The book offers a narrative that blends math history with cultural impact, letting you appreciate phi beyond formulas. If you enjoy uncovering the hidden connections between math and the world around you, this book provides a richly detailed exploration, though it might be less suited if you prefer purely technical treatises.

Charles Seife, a seasoned science journalist and NYU professor, explores the complex history of zero with a narrative that challenges how you think about this essential yet controversial number. You learn about zero's journey from Babylonian invention to its feared status in ancient Greece and revered role in Hindu culture, alongside its darker chapters like medieval heresy hunts and modern-day computational challenges such as Y2K. The book offers detailed stories and historical context that illuminate zero's profound impact on mathematics and society, making it a compelling read if you want to grasp how a simple concept shaped civilization's intellectual evolution. It’s especially suited for anyone intrigued by the intersection of math, history, and culture, though those seeking purely technical math might find it more historical than theoretical.

Unlike most math history books that merely recount dates and names, Carl B. Boyer's History of Analytic Geometry offers an integrated survey tracing the evolution of analytic geometry from ancient Alexandrian ideas through the contributions of Fermat, Descartes, Newton, Euler, and culminating in the vibrant "Golden Age" between 1789 and 1850. You gain insight into how each mathematical breakthrough built on previous generations, deepening your understanding of the subject's intellectual progression. The book balances historical narrative with accessible explanations, making it suitable for anyone with a mathematical inclination who wants to grasp both the concepts and their historical significance. Chapters such as the detailed treatment of Descartes’ coordinate system reveal how foundational ideas shaped the entire field.

Millions have turned to Luke Hodgkin's "A History of Mathematics" to explore how mathematics evolved across diverse civilizations, blending Eastern and Western traditions into a unified narrative. You gain insight into the contributions of figures like Archimedes and Alan Turing, while chapters on Islamic and Chinese mathematics broaden your understanding beyond the usual Eurocentric view. The book delves into modern breakthroughs such as chaos theory and Fermat's Last Theorem, offering more than 100 illustrations and exercises that challenge your grasp of mathematical development. Ideal if you want a global perspective and a detailed journey through math’s milestones, this book demands engagement but rewards with depth and clarity.

What if everything you knew about the rise of American mathematics was incomplete? Karen Hunger Parshall and David E. Rowe delve into the pivotal quarter-century from 1876 to 1900, charting how the United States evolved from a peripheral player to a major force in mathematical research. You’ll explore the lives and contributions of J.J. Sylvester, Felix Klein, and E.H. Moore, alongside the institutions that shaped their work, such as Johns Hopkins and the University of Chicago. The book reveals how broader scientific, educational, and social factors influenced American mathematics, making it a revealing read if you're interested in the roots of modern mathematical scholarship and academic networks.

John Derbyshire, a mathematician and linguist turned systems analyst, offers a vivid tour through algebra's history that blends deep mathematical insight with narrative clarity. You’ll explore algebra from its ancient origins in Mesopotamia to the abstract breakthroughs of Galois, gaining a nuanced understanding of how algebra transformed not just mathematics but ways of thinking. Chapters guide you through complex ideas like group theory with enough rigor to challenge but not overwhelm, making it suitable for those comfortable with formulas. If you’re curious about the evolution of mathematical thought and want a book that respects your intellect without dumbing down, this is a fitting choice.

Unlike most math history books that spotlight abstract theories, Eleanor Robson's work digs into how mathematics functioned as a vital tool within ancient Iraqi society. She draws on an impressive collection of clay tablets to demonstrate how math was intertwined with politics, economics, and religion over three millennia. Through detailed chapters, you’ll uncover how early accounting evolved into sophisticated astronomical calculations, reshaping the common narrative about the region’s intellectual contributions. This book suits those curious about the real-world application of ancient math and its cultural significance rather than just its theoretical developments.
